Hi, and welcome to the Maplight on-call rotation! Most pages you'll get are about the tile-rendering cache layer — usually stale tiles or eviction storms after a style update. Nine times out of ten a targeted cache flush fixes it. Before paging the render team, please work through the triage steps on our internal page.

operations page: https://jenkins.zemvarcloud.local/job/merge_requests/repo/build/73930b4b30f0a8ed

Welcome to the Crumbline on-call rotation! One quirk you'll hit fast: bakery partners on the Ovenly platform have a hard order cutoff at 14:00 local time. The scheduler job enforces it, but if it stalls, orders leak past cutoff and the Tarthaven kitchens get very grumpy. You can manually re-run the cutoff sweep from the ops console — it requires a signed request. Use the signing key below:

release key, fajef-kajeg: bky19_LdLu6Ne6FLi8he2c24d

Handover: Bramblewick admin dashboard dark mode, from Ines to Kofi. Theme tokens done; charts and the billing table still hardcode colors. Toggle is behind the ui_dark flag — keep it off for Thursday's release. Contrast audit passed except the alerts panel. No migration needed. Remaining work and screenshots for the release checklist are on the dark-mode tracking page.

runbook for badug-kadup: https://confluence.zemvarlabs.internal/projects/browse/display/projects/bd1b